News summary

Indian boxer Nikhat Zareen faced a devastating 0-5 defeat against China's Wu Yu in the pre-quarterfinals at the Paris Olympics, marking what she called the hardest loss of her career. Despite extensive preparation, including training on an empty stomach and struggling with sleep before the match, Nikhat could not overcome her opponent, who is also the reigning Asian Games champion and 2023 world champion. This loss has been emotionally taxing for her, prompting a vow to return stronger as she expressed deep gratitude for the opportunity to compete. Nikhat plans to take a solo trip for recovery and spend time with family, reaffirming her commitment to pursue her Olympic dreams. The two-time world champion's journey was fraught with challenges leading up to the Games, but she remains determined to chase her goal of winning an Olympic medal. Her emotional response post-fight highlighted the sacrifices she made and the weight of national expectations she carried into the ring.
